Our client, a large professional services organisation is seeking a Junior Learning and Development Advisor to join their team on a hybrid working basis in either of their Basingstoke or Farnham offices. This is a fantastic opportunity to join a business that is on a strong growth trajectory. You will play a key role in supporting the delivery of high-quality learning and development across the business. You'll combine excellent organisation, attention to detail, people skills, and a passion for development, to help the business grow capability, support their trainees, and create a learning culture everyone can thrive in. You will help ensure accurate, proficient, and comprehensive day to day running of the Talent Management Function across various training solutions and the employee lifecycle. Full UK Driving License and vehicle access is required as weekly same-day travel will be required.
As Junior Learning & Development advisor, some of your role responsibilities include:
- Be the first point of contact for Talent Management and learning queries, providing support and escalating issues when needed
- Work with managers to understand development needs and help identify suitable learning solutions and development plans
- Coordinate firmwide learning programmes, including leadership and management development, onboarding and workshops
- Manage learning event logistics
- Communicate with participants before and after events
- Support the design and promotion of learning activities, including creating course materials and promotional content using Canva
- Manage day-to-day administration of learning systems
- Support compliance requirements, including professional qualifications, regulatory training and technical courses (e.g. ACCA / ICAEW)
- Produce reports on training activity
About you:
You will have experience of working in an L&D environment, preferably within a corporate or professional services business and you will have a real interest in progressing a career within L&D. You may have started or be eager to begin the level 3 or 5 CIPD qualification (or similar L&D/HR qualification). Confident written and verbal communication skills. Ability to manage multiple tasks, deadlines, and learning events simultaneously with experience co-ordinating logistics (venues, equipment, catering, materials, etc.). Familiarity with Learning Management Systems or Digital Learning Tools. Proficient in MS Office/ 365 applications, specifically Excel and familiarity with virtual collaboration platforms (e.g., Teams, Zoom) for scheduling events. Experience with digital design tools such as Canva for creating course materials would be of great benefit. Enjoy working collaboratively as part of a team and self-motivated when working independently.
